Early Help Assessment Guidance and Template

Early Help guidance will support practitioners from universal services to ensure a consistent approach in completing Early Help Assessments. An early help assessment is a way of gathering information about children, young people and families in one place and using that information to help decide what type of support is needed.  People from different organisations will talk to each other, share information and work together with the family’s consent. 

Good quality information and analysis is required to inform and develop an effective and supportive intervention to improve outcomes for children, young people and families.
